1985 Toyota MR2

I bought the car in Sept. of 2002 with just over 76,000 miles on it. This MR2 was sold to my good friend Matt S. It will be cared for and driven well.

Farewell! You will be missed and hopefully one day replaced by yet another MR2.



Last Modifications:

* K&N eXtreme Air Filter
* Toyota Rear Clear spoiler

* Rota SubZero 15x6.5" wheels, color bronze

* Falcon Azenis Sport 205x50

* new pads and rotors, front and back
* Jon O shift kit
* Twos R Us 'Naked' Billet Aluminum Shift Knob
* Custom Exhaust 2.5" with 18" Magnaflow Muffler

* NGK plugs

* OEM Side skirts (not installed)

I take it yours was supercharged?

There were two engines available- the 4A-GE 16v NA and the 4A-GZE 16v supercharged.

Otherwise, don't know what you mean by supped up.. they were hot little 16v. Formula Atlantic spec cranked out 250hp out of the 1.6 liter engine, NA.
